Rayan Ait-Nouri was at the end of Zabarnyi’s challenge that finally justified a red card, and the exuberant Wing back was forced on Saturday with a knock on Saturday. He is a doubt about the game on Tuesday, and the fast turnaround works against him.

Jorgen Strand Larsen recently returned from his setback of injuries and should lead the line in Molineux, but the hosts are still without Hwang Hee-Chan, Sasa Kalajdzic, Yerson Mosquera, Leon Chiwone and Enso Gonzalez.

January -Cunft Emmanuel Agbadou is also doubt, so we could see how another newcomer, wet djiga, started in Pereia’s back.

It looks as if Silva had to trace a little back in midfield after Emile Smith Rowe and Tom Cairney picked up knocking at the weekend. Cairney was forced in the second half after getting in.

The couple are doubts about visiting Molineux, with Andreas Pereira returning a candidate to the manager’s XI if Smith Rowe does not fit.

Visitors will surely be without Harry Wilson, Reiss Nelson and Kenny Tete on Tuesday evening.
